Earthy Eyes

Smoky, earth-toned eyeshadows in shades of bronzy copper, sandy brown, and rich chocolate are having a well-deserved moment in the spotlight. This warm, toasty color palette feels so right for fall. Top it off with a lengthening mascara for the perfect finishing touch.

Garnet Lips

I know, red lips for fall? Groundbreaking. But, these deep garnet hues—complete with luxe packaging and moisturizing formulas—are a whole new level of glamour. Use them as the finishing touch to your full beat, or take a page out of the French-girl beauty book and wear this hue with no other makeup to look instantly put-together.

Toasted "Blonzer"

Although summer's almost over, the sun-kissed "blonzer" look is showing no signs of slowing down for the cooler weather. Just grab a toasted terracotta shade, or layer a rouge blush over bronzer and blend them to create your own custom shade.

Silky Skin

Whether you're going for glass skin, dumpling skin, or cloud skin, skin-first makeup is in. Use a dewy, hydrating foundation to nail these looks. Then, go in with liquid highlighter cream and airbrushing setting spray to amp up the glow.
